Title
A Kitchen Tale
Author
Mark Jennison
Mark has worked in theatres from Moscow to Minneapolis as a director, actor and scenic artist. He is currently a freelance translator living in France and the author of six plays that have had public readings or full productions in the Paris area. The Nose was produced by Le Théâtre Tourtour in 1995 and marked the beginning of his playwriting career.
Synopsis
A certain Lord has returned to his native land where his Western lifestyle is not very well appreciated. In the face of death threats, he decides to throw a dinner party. His kitchen staff tells the story of Don Juan, mixing GIA with passion while they cook and serve the meal, using the elements in the kitchen to act out the tale. This play within a play ultimately unmasks the traitor that is amongst them, but not before justice is served and blood is shed. View extract.
Cast
3 male, 2 female
Duration
110 minutes
